Decoding the Nutritional Profiles: Honeydew
Let's start with honeydew. This sweet, pale green melon is a powerhouse of essential nutrients. When we talk about honeydew nutrition, we're primarily focused on its vitamin and mineral content. Specifically, honeydew is a good source of Vitamin C, a vital antioxidant that helps protect your cells from damage. It's also packed with potassium, which is critical for maintaining healthy blood pressure and supporting heart function. Moreover, honeydew provides a decent amount of fiber, aiding in digestion and keeping you feeling full longer.
Vitamin C is a big deal. Not only does it help bolster your immune system, but it also aids in collagen production, which is essential for healthy skin, bones, and tissues. A serving of honeydew can contribute a significant portion of your daily Vitamin C needs. Next up, we have potassium, a crucial electrolyte that helps regulate fluid balance in the body and supports proper muscle and nerve function. If you're someone who is physically active, potassium is especially important to help prevent muscle cramps. Then there is fiber, which helps prevent constipation and promoting healthy digestion. Honeydew is also a good source of hydration since it has high water content.
But wait, there's more! Honeydew also contains other beneficial nutrients like Vitamin B6, which is important for brain development and function, and magnesium, which supports muscle and nerve function, along with regulating blood sugar levels and blood pressure. The sugar in honeydew is primarily fructose, a naturally occurring sugar, so while it contributes to the melon's sweetness, it's a better choice than processed sugars. If you're watching your calorie intake, honeydew is a relatively low-calorie food, making it a great option for those looking to maintain a healthy weight. Plus, the water content helps to keep you hydrated and supports overall health. Overall, honeydew is a nutritional winner.
Unveiling the Nutritional Treasures: Cantaloupe
Alright, let's switch gears and talk about cantaloupe. This vibrant orange melon is another nutritional superstar. The nutrition in cantaloupe is just outstanding. It shines when it comes to Vitamin A. Cantaloupe is one of the best food sources of this important nutrient. It is also a good source of Vitamin C, potassium, and several other vitamins and minerals. The bright orange color of cantaloupe comes from beta-carotene, which the body converts into Vitamin A. This is great for your vision, your immune system, and your skin's health. You'll find a nice dose of antioxidants and fiber in cantaloupe, too.
Let's take a closer look. Vitamin A is key for healthy vision, immune function, and cell growth. Cantaloupe is loaded with it. Think about how important it is for your eyes, especially as you age. Cantaloupe provides a substantial amount of Vitamin A, helping to keep your eyes sharp and functioning well. Then, we have Vitamin C, which is another powerful antioxidant that cantaloupe provides a good dose of. This vitamin helps protect your cells from damage, which is crucial for overall health and well-being. Potassium is also a vital mineral in cantaloupe, supporting heart health and helping to regulate blood pressure. It aids the muscle and nerve function of the body.
Cantaloupe also contains some B vitamins, which are important for energy production and other bodily functions. Fiber is present as well and can help keep your digestive system running smoothly, while also making you feel satisfied after eating. The high water content in cantaloupe keeps you hydrated, which is important for almost every function in your body. It is also lower in calories and an excellent choice for a snack or dessert if you are trying to lose weight or maintain a healthy weight. Overall, cantaloupe packs an excellent nutritional punch, making it a wonderful addition to any healthy diet.
Head-to-Head: Comparing the Nutritional Value
Time for the honeydew vs. cantaloupe nutrition face-off! While both melons are nutritional powerhouses, they each have their strengths. Let's pit them against each other and see where they stand in terms of key nutrients.
In terms of Vitamin A, cantaloupe steals the show. The beta-carotene content gives it a huge advantage. Honeydew doesn't have nearly as much. However, both melons are rich in Vitamin C. But in the Vitamin C category, both melons provide a significant amount, making them both great choices for boosting your immune system. Moving on to potassium, both cantaloupe and honeydew are good sources. This is essential for heart health and maintaining healthy blood pressure. When it comes to fiber, they're both pretty comparable, offering a good amount to support healthy digestion. Both are low in calories and have a high water content, making them great choices for hydration and weight management. Overall, it really depends on what you're looking for. If you want a Vitamin A boost, go for cantaloupe. If you want a slightly sweeter flavor and a good dose of Vitamin C and potassium, honeydew is a great pick. You can always enjoy both. When buying, choose melons that are heavy for their size and have a sweet aroma. Store them uncut at room temperature until ripe, and then refrigerate. Cut melons should be stored in the fridge.
